jacques reymond

had dinner last night at Jacques Reymond with Wyn and co
followed my GPS navigation down and was surprised it was so close to Lauriston!
yup, that fact had absolutely nothing to do with the restaurant review,
i was just amazed it took me so long to realise
phoon = geography fail

had the degustation
8 courses including desserts, but no accompanying wines because i drove
(but almost off my P plates, thank god!)

click here for the menu
http://www.jacquesreymond.com.au/documents/JacquesReymondsmenu2009..pdf

didnt take that many photos, but here are the few i did take

Hiramasa kingfish and ponzu, Hervey Bay scallop, spiced nougatine with peanuts,warm leek and chilli gherkin dressing

Wagyu beef rump, oyster sauce and condiments, ravioli of daikon and spicy celery,mustard ice cream. Paid extra for the fresh truffles pictured, we were lucky they had them and it really made the dish for me. was my favourite of the night. tender and complex, just wish mustard was spicier!

Martini of bittersweet chocolate, whisky and espresso granita,bourbon vanilla chantilly

regret not having the white chocolate crème brulée, mild spice cacao sorbet, milk chocolate millefeuilles,dark chocolate soufflé like everyone else (picture above!), mostly because although the earl grey and orange tea icecream with pear dessert i did get was good, it wasnt great. i wanted a chocolately high!

Anyway, Il Bacaro, one chef's hat if you were wondering
was gooooooooooddd
mains were slightly hit and miss, and the butter for my bread was underwhelming
but the entree and dessert made up for it.

might be my favourite Italian restaurant in Melbourne
sorry for the blurry photographs btw, my camera is on its last legs

Pacific bay oysters and cucumber granita

wagyu carpaccio YUM. must get this!

Prawn, pea and saffron risotto


hazelnut and chocolate pudding, and behind is a lavender pannacotta with honeycomb.

I love lavender anything. so this panna cotta was delicious, and the homemade honeycomb suited the creamy texture right down to a T, but everyone else described it as 'opening your mouth and walking into a toilet'. hmm. maybe for lavender lovers only?



Partial as i am to lavender, this dessert was THE BOMB. lightly press the sugar sprinkled outsides and the pudding erupts, spilling out warm decadent molten chocolate, with whole bits of hazelnuts. Have that with the marscapone ice cream, and then have a taste of the kumquat jam to finish off. What a work of contrasts. HEAVEN.
